  13. Supposedly. There's a lot that's fishy about that one.

    1) What's that screen? It seems to be some sort of benchmark or just an ordinary screenshot of something. It doesn't move and the writing at the bottom doesn't correlate to anything iPhone-related.

    2) Why doesn't he do anything else with it? If the phone was remotely wiped, he'd get the normal "Connect to iTunes" screen.

    3) How the hell did it get to Vietnam?

    4) There's no way in hell Apple would let another one leak, not with the massive publicity they got with the first (only?) one that did and all the legal action that's going down. They'd have those protos locked down tighter than a gitmo detainee.

    5) At 3:07 he presses the home button but nothing happens.

    6) This one says 16MB on the back instead of XXMB. Could mean it's a more finalized pre-production model, though.

    If it's a fake, it's a pretty convincing fake from all observable angles save for whatever that is on the screen. But I'm not convinced this is genuine.
